Continue ReadingWe have arrived at midseason fast! Here are names (one-two from each Sub-One team) of prospects whose stocks are rising in PA, ranked or unranked!
Tyler Woodman | 5’9, 170 | RB/DB | Quakertown | 2022
Woodman’s a highly productive senior out of Quakertown HS. Little bit of DB work but primarily the lead back at QHS. 13 touchdowns halfway through the season. Awesome gait and good balance. Reps as QTHS’s kick returner as well. Deployed most frequently in a two-back set with both backs’ hands in the dirt pre-snap. Absolutely glides on jump cuts, good peripheral vision to jump-cut outside of tackle box if an initial hole is closed. Woodman seems to have an answer for every tackle angle taken against him. Home-run speed is all he’s lacking. He’s got the short-area burst to thrive on inside zone runs, his change-of-direction ability is a plus as well. He provides Quakertown with so much, add blocking and an occasional screen pass to his responsibilities. I love how Woodman lets things develop in front of him, not often running into lanes before they are open.

Nyfise McIntyre | 5’10, 180 | RB | Upper Dublin | 2023
Wrote a little about how impressed I was with 21’s efforts in live action this past weekend. Here’s a little more on McIntyre’s game after some more film study. This kid gets a ton of traction, gearing up with heavy arm swings to really run through arm tackles. Aggressive mindset, tone-setter, runs with an attitude. Solid bounce ability, is seen gliding after handoff to let blocks develop. This kid is a great short-distance runner and could be a dominant red-zone presence if Upper Dublin wants him to be. I love his repertoire of moves in the open field. He isn’t the most elusive but will still try to cut on you. Nasty stiff arm, hesitation moves, spin moves after contact, you name it. The tape shows he can be trusted to catch out of the backfield, a huge component of his recruitment. I want to see more in this area though! Stock rising!
Levi Carroll Levi Carroll 6'4" | 180 lbs | WR North Penn | 2022 State PA | 6’4, 180 | WR | North Penn | 2022
268 is far too low of a ranking for this kid. I’ll be first to say it. Carroll is the first non-RB on the list. Awesome, desirable build for an outside lane wideout. I’m blown away by this kid’s size/speed combination. Carroll isn’t a quick-footed slot prospect whose speed comes from foot quickness, this kid is going to burn you with his effortless stride. 6’4, hardly looks like he’s breaking a sweat, next thing you know he’s behind the defense sizing up a deep ball from Zeltt. His gait is super clean which allows him to seamlessly transition out of breaks and into his stem. Serious vertical threat. Can work with his QB on the fly, showing he has good situation awareness. Can’t speak enough about his hands, loads of catches away from his body. Good understanding of route manipulation. I don’t come across too many 6’4 kick returners in high school, or anywhere to be honest. He’s a kick returner and a damn good one. His big body allows him to eat up physical contact at the catch point. He’s beating defenders above their head downfield and behind the line of scrimmage in the screen game. What can’t he do? 268 is too low!
Cameryn Jackson Cameryn Jackson 5'10" | 165 lbs | RB Upper Moreland | 2022 State PA | 5’10, 165 | RB/DB | Upper Moreland | 2022
Arguably the best open-field wiggle, elusiveness of this list. Slithery is the best way to describe the kid. He cuts with a purpose, gets low on each cut, displaying serious ankle bend and balance. Awesome overall quickness with the ball in his hands. Three lateral steps can create a ton of displacement. Jackson is the highest-ranking prospect in this piece, his midseason tape has proved our rankings right on him. Pass catcher out of the backfield. Elite kick return ability. Best straight-line speed in this piece. This kid can stop and cut on a dime, not sure how his knee doesn’t explode each time. This kid is a dancer in the open field. Great flexibility equals great athleticism. He also contributes as a defensive back.
Kyle Lehman Kyle Lehman 5'9" | 165 lbs | RB Wissahickon | 2023 PA | 5’9, 180 | RB/ATH | Wissahickon | 2023
Here’s another high-volume producer at running back, this time out of Wissahickon HS. Lehman can cut at seemingly full speed. He’s got home-run hitting speed that allows him to take inside zone handoffs all the way to the house. Good initial vision in the backfield. Patient in the angles he takes, confident enough in his burst to be patient. He’s such a good all-around back, that there is too much for defenders to think about when sizing him up in open space. Quick upfield burst combined with disciplined eyes keeps defenders on edge and off guard. This kid isn’t weak in any sense of the word, before you know it it’s time to meet him in the whole, if you’re thinking, he’s going to win. A lot to think about when tackling Lehman.
Mustafa Thompson Mustafa Thompson 5'11" | 185 lbs | DB Wissahickon | 2022 State PA | 5’11, 180 | DB | Wissahickon | 2022
Here’s a new name to the site. Mustafa Thompson Mustafa Thompson 5'11" | 185 lbs | DB Wissahickon | 2022 State PA provides Wissahickon with good off-coverage and aggressive press coverage from his outside cornerback spot. Good overall awareness, especially when his backside is to the sideline. Really consistent footwork when his target is working outside in. Not too many false steps are seen throughout his tape. Kid has a long and productive tape thus far. Ton of PBU’s on the year. Confidence shows pre/post snap. I wonder what his overall athleticism is like, he’s a little bit on the heavier side when thinking about your traditional cornerback size. The extra weight allows him to absorb contact better and not be bullied and/or manipulated throughout a route. Has a desire to get physical against the run. Solid job containing outside sweeps and bounce-outs. Shaky initially when in press coverage. Can get behind a step if the wideout can make Thompson miss on a jam. Solid recovery ability. Solid bail technique. Can be a tough release if you allow him to get a jam on you. Can really steer wideouts out of the play with a stiff jam at the LOS. I like this kid’s first couple of games. Excited to see more.
